This year marks the 101st anniversary of the Macy’s Thanksgiving Parade, and for many of us, it’s hard to imagine the holiday without the parade, which marks the occasion with floats and musical performances. Yet when the very first parade took place, on November 27, 1924, it looked quite different from what we know today. To begin with, it wasn’t called a Thanksgiving parade; instead, Macy’s billed it as the Macy’s Christmas Parade, a celebration for the newly expanded Herald Square store.
